Abstract

This study examines the role of local wisdom in the life cycle of the Nagekeo people of Flores and its function as a foundation for preserving cultural identity amid globalization. Using a qualitative cultural approach, the research explores how traditional rituals—from birth to death—serve not only as symbols of spirituality but also as expressions of social cohesion and intergenerational continuity. Findings indicate that the Nagekeo community has adapted to the pressures of modernization and religion by integrating new meanings into long-standing traditions. Rituals that once centered on ancestral belief are now practiced alongside Christian values, creating a form of cultural synthesis that sustains both heritage and faith. Despite challenges such as commercialization and generational gaps, local wisdom remains a living framework guiding moral, social, and spiritual life. Thus, the preservation of cultural identity in Nagekeo demonstrates how tradition can coexist with modernity through creative adaptation and intergenerational participation.
